
A 27-year-old carpenter, identified as Toheeb Ahmed has allegedly killed his grandmother in Ore, headquarters of Odigbo Local Government area of Ondo State.
Thefrontrank gathered that the tragic incident which occurred at Aiyegbami Street, had threw the entire community into confusion.
According to eyewitnesses, the suspect was apprehended early Tuesday morning after suspicious movements around the victim’s residence.
A neighbour, who narrated the incident, said, “he has been coming to the house since last Thursday at midnight.
“This morning, he came to my shop to buy something and said, ‘Mama is dead.’ I felt sorry at first, but when he told me not to inform anyone, I became suspicious.
“Out of curiosity, I went to Mama’s room while he was away and discovered she had been hacked to death.
“When he returned, I noticed he was carrying a cutlass and was accompanied by a friend, probably to move the corpse. That was when I raised the alarm.”
It was further gathered that the deceased, who had been blind for many years, lived quietly in the community.
Shocked residents described the incident as heartbreaking, attributing it to youthful recklessness and moral decay among the younger generation.
The spokesperson for the Police Command in the state, Mr Olayinka Ayanlade, while confirming the incident, said the suspect has been arrested.
Ayanlade said investigation is ongoing to unravel the circumstances surrounding the incident.
